When selecting vinyl blinds for your home, it's essential to consider several key features that can enhance both style and functionality. One of the primary factors is the opacity level; vinyl blinds come in various grades of opacity, allowing you to choose the perfect balance between light control and privacy. For spaces like bedrooms or media rooms, consider options with a higher opacity that effectively block out light, while in areas like kitchens or living rooms, lighter options might be more suitable.
Another important consideration is the material quality. Vinyl blinds are available in different thicknesses and finishes, which can impact their durability and appearance. Thicker materials typically offer better resistance to warping and fading, ensuring longevity. Additionally, look for blinds that feature UV protection to prevent discoloration caused by sunlight, maintaining the aesthetic appeal of your interior space.
**Tips:** When measuring for your vinyl blinds, ensure you take precise measurements of your window frame to avoid sizing issues. It's also beneficial to consider the maintenance of the blinds; most vinyl options are easy to clean, requiring just a damp cloth for upkeep. Finally, think about the style of the blinds—whether you prefer traditional slats or a more modern fabric-like look, ensure they complement your overall home decor for a cohesive design.

When it comes to maintaining vinyl blinds for enduring beauty and functionality, a few key practices can extend their lifespan significantly. According to the Window Coverings Association of America, vinyl blinds can last anywhere from 5 to 10 years with proper care. Regular cleaning is essential; dust and dirt can accumulate, leading to discoloration and wear. A simple weekly wipe with a damp cloth or using a vacuum's brush attachment can effectively keep them looking fresh. For deeper cleaning, a mixture of mild soap and warm water can remove tougher stains without damaging the material.
In addition to regular cleaning, it’s important to be aware of how to operate vinyl blinds. Slamming or yanking the cords can stress the mechanisms and lead to premature damage. The American Blinds Association recommends gentle handling when raising or lowering the slats, ensuring smooth operation. Furthermore, placing blinds away from direct heat sources, such as radiators or heating vents, will help prevent warping and fading, thus maintaining their aesthetic appeal. By following these simple maintenance tips, homeowners can ensure their vinyl blinds remain a stylish and economical choice for years to come.
